Nazero Constructions Pty Ltd v North Sydney Council [2002] NSWLEC 193

Nazero Constructions Pty Ltd v North Sydney Council [2002] NSWLEC 193

The development application is for a residential flat building, not a duplex as defined under North Sydney Local Environmental Plan 2001, and thus is for a prohibited purpose; further, the necessary physical preconditions for the prior consent have not been met and the original consent cannot be acted upon without modification. Accordingly, the appeal is dismissed.

Procedural Posture

Appeal (class 1 Development Application Refusal) / Preliminary Questions of Law, Ex Tempore Judgment

  1. 1 Whether the proposed development can be categorised as a 'duplex' under NSLEP 2001
  2. 2 Whether there is any permissible use for consent if not classified as a duplex
  3. 3 Whether the original Court consent can be acted upon

Ratio Decidendi

The development application is for a residential flat building, not a duplex as defined under North Sydney Local Environmental Plan 2001, and thus is for a prohibited purpose; further, the necessary physical preconditions for the prior consent have not been met and the original consent cannot be acted upon without modification. Accordingly, the appeal is dismissed.

Court Disposition

Application dismissed

Orders

  • The application is dismissed.
  • The hearing dates of 17 November 2002 and 18 November 2002 are vacated.
